The Indian textiles industry has witnessed a growth of 11% during the 11th Five-Year-Plan.
This was revealed by Minister of State for Textiles – Ms Panabaaka Lakshmi in the Rajya Sabha – the Upper House of Parliament.
The government has implemented several policy initiatives like Technology Upgradation Fund Scheme (TUFs), Scheme for Integrated Textile Parks (SITP), Integrated Skill Development Scheme and export promotion schemes for development of powerloom sector.
This will further boost rapid modernization of cotton textile industry, the Rajya Sabha was informed.
The Textiles Ministry has also conducted a study of benchmarking of apparel industry with reference to the sector in China and Bangladesh.
Key findings of the study like improved statistical collection, strengthening export credit guarantee schemes (EPCG), adherence to timely supplies, low power and labour costs have been adopted in the 12th Five-Year-Plan.
